site stats

Linux cache miss statistics

NettetNuma policy hit/miss statistics — The Linux Kernel documentation Numa policy hit/miss statistics ¶ /sys/devices/system/node/node*/numastat All units are pages. Hugepages have separate counters. The numa_hit, numa_miss and numa_foreign counters reflect how well processes are able to allocate memory from nodes they prefer. Nettet14. des. 2024 · The performance of cache memory is frequently measured in terms of a quantity called Hit ratio. Hit ratio = hit / (hit + miss) = no. of hits/total accesses. To monitor the performance of your cache, linux provides some excellent library: …

Is there a way to get Cache Hit/Miss ratios for block …

NettetThe Configure Analysis window opens. From HOW pane, click the Browse button and select Memory Access. Configure the following options: Click the Start button to run the analysis. Limitations: Memory objects analysis can be configured for Linux* targets only and only for processors based on Intel microarchitecture code name Sandy Bridge or … Nettetcachetop - Statistics for linux page cache hit/miss ratios per processes. Uses Linux eBPF/bcc. SYNOPSIS cachetop [interval] DESCRIPTION This traces four kernel … buccaneer bike ride english https://theprologue.org

Ubuntu Manpage: cachestat - Statistics for linux page cache hit/miss …

NettetIf passthrough is selected, useful when the cache contents are not known to be coherent with the origin device, then all reads are served from the origin device (all reads miss … Nettet今天我们来聊一聊perf,一个非常重要的Linux性能工具。本文是perf系列的第一篇文章,后续会继续介绍perf,包括用法、原理和相关的经典文章。 perf是什么? perf … http://nickdesaulniers.github.io/blog/2024/06/02/speeding-up-linux-kernel-builds-with-ccache/ express scripts arizona fax number

Tutorial - Perf Wiki - Linux kernel

Category:Ubuntu Manpage: cachestat - Measure page cache hits/misses.

Tags:Linux cache miss statistics

Linux cache miss statistics

Cache — The Linux Kernel documentation

NettetProcedure. To release the caches, prime the Linux kernel's drop_caches knob to release cached memory. Before doing this, run the sync command to ensure that all "dirty" … Nettet6. mar. 2024 · cache-misses also includes prefetch requests and code fetch requests that miss in the L3 cache. All of these events only count core-originating requests. …

Linux cache miss statistics

Did you know?

Nettet2. jun. 2024 · Only access A [4] will be a miss. Hence miss rate is 0.25 For m=2, After accessing A [0], the cache holds the same line. Next access is A [2] which is a hit, and A [4] is a miss and so on. So miss rate is 0.5. Note that total cache size is 8 doubles. Nettet2. jun. 2024 · No caching took 647.07s, initial cold cache build took 735.22s (13.62% slower), and subsequent hot cache builds took 98.9s (6.54x faster). YMMV based on CPU and disk performance. Also, it’s not the most common workflow to do clean builds, but we do this for Linux kernel builds for Android/Pixel at work, and this helps me significantly …

Nettet5. jul. 2024 · 用linux perf命令来分析程序的cpu cache miss现象_perf cache miss_涛歌依旧的博客-CSDN博客 用linux perf命令来分析程序的cpu cache miss现象 涛歌依旧 于 2024-07-05 22:24:05 发布 17372 收藏 15 分类专栏: s2: 软件进阶 s2: Linux杂项 s4: 计算机组成 版权 s2: 软件进阶 同时被 3 个专栏收录 1053 篇文章 66 订阅 订阅专栏 s2: … http://www.brendangregg.com/perf.html

Nettet24. jan. 2012 · You can use perf to access the hardware performance counters: $ perf stat -e dTLB-load-misses,iTLB-load-misses /path/to/command e.g. : $ perf stat -e dTLB-load-misses,iTLB-load-misses /bin/ls > /dev/null Performance counter stats for '/bin/ls': 5,775 dTLB-load-misses 1,059 iTLB-load-misses 0.001897682 seconds time elapsed Share Nettet10. apr. 2024 · Synopsis The remote Oracle Linux host is missing one or more security updates. Description The remote Oracle Linux 7 host has packages installed that are affected by multiple vulnerabilities as referenced in the ELSA-2024-12242 advisory.

Nettet2. mai 2010 · Combined instruction and data figures for the LL cache follow that. Note that the LL miss rate is computed relative to the total number of memory accesses, not the number of L1 misses. I.e. it is (ILmr + DLmr + DLmw) / (Ir + Dr + Dw) not (ILmr + DLmr + DLmw) / (I1mr + D1mr + D1mw) Branch prediction statistics are not collected by default.

NettetPreparing Red Hat Enterprise Linux for an Oracle Database Installation" Collapse section "30. Preparing Red Hat Enterprise Linux for an Oracle Database ... If you look at the usage figures you can see that most of the memory use is for buffers and cache. Linux always tries to use RAM to speed up disk operations by using available memory ... buccaneer blast regattaNettet29. jan. 2024 · There are two kinds of methods of how the cache is used: cachepool and cache volumes (cachevol). The main difference is that cachepool is using two logical volumes to store the actual cache and the cache metadata, where cachevol is using one device for both. If you have more than one LV to cache it may be better to use … buccaneer blast 2022Nettetdm-cache is a device mapper target written by Joe Thornber, Heinz Mauelshagen, and Mike Snitzer. It aims to improve performance of a block device (eg, a spindle) by dynamically migrating some of its data to a faster, smaller device (eg, an SSD). This device-mapper solution allows us to insert this caching at different levels of the dm … express scripts bin 017010Nettet2. feb. 2024 · ccache -s. Now you can see that cache is in full use. When the maximum cache size is reached, ccache will delete the less used records. To reset the stats, run: ccache -z. To clear the cache, run: ccache -C. Ccache will call the package manager and cl-kernel automatically. If you want to use ccache for any GCC compilation, reset the … express scripts benefit cardNettet24. jan. 2012 · As a side effect, minor page faults always incur TLB misses. On the other hand, a TLB miss occurs when the the translation entry for a page is not residing in the … express scripts billing phone numberNettet31. des. 2014 · After a 2 second sleep, a cksum command was issued at 8:29:01, for an 80 Mbyte file (called "80m"), which caused a total of ~20,400 misses ("MISSES" column), … buccaneer bleacher reportNettet17. mar. 2024 · Perf is a profiler tool for Linux 2.6+ based systems that abstracts away CPU hardware differences in Linux performance measurements and presents a simple commandline interface. Perf is based on the perf_events interface exported by recent versions of the Linux kernel. This article demonstrates the perf tool through example runs. buccaneer blast